Weather Averages for Alcudia in August
Averages for Alcudia in August
August is the warmest month of the year in Alcudia, and this means it is also extremely busy. On some days the humidity in Alcudia can get a bit uncomfortable, with the average humidity for the month being about 72%.
The average temperature now reaches a warm high of 30°C (that's about 86°F) during the day and only falls as low as 19°C (that's about 66°F) in the evenings.
The average sea temperature is around 25°C (that's about 77°F), so you can head to the beach to top up your tan or indulge in some watersports activities such as waterskiing, jetskiing, surfing or snorkelling.
Be sure to wear sunscreen with a high SPF and seek shelter from the sun during the hottest parts of the day. You can check the local weather report to find out when this is.
